Roland E. Laue, 86, of Effingham, IL, passed away on Tuesday, July 28, 2020 at Effingham Rehabilitation and Health Care Center in Effingham.

A memorial visitation celebrating Roland and his sister Carolyn Mick will be held from 4:00 p.m. to 6:00 p.m. Friday, August 7, 2020 at Johnson Funeral Home in Effingham. Burial will be in Trinity Lutheran Cemetery in Shumway at a later date. In lieu of flowers, memorials may be made to the American Heart Association. Roland was born on November 1, 1933 in Effingham, IL, the son of Benjamin and Mildred (Owens) Laue. He married Irene Faye Albrecht and to this union were born Jeremy, Kelly and Michael. She preceded him in death. He later married Mary Carolyn Wiedman and she preceded him in death. Roland served his country in the United States Navy as a Radioman 1st Class RM1. He retired from Firestone in Decatur, and later worked in the paint department at Walmart. Roland also worked at Carol’s Package Liquor with his sister. He enjoyed gardening and traveling.

Roland is survived by his son, Michael Laue of Decatur; grandchildren, Ben Laue, Melanie Laue, and Kimberly (Ryan) Childress; 4 great-grandchildren; step-daughter, Anastasia Fears of Worden; sisters, Judith (George) Hansen of Glen Ellyn and Gayle Robbins of Shumway; and sister-in-law, Donna Laue of Alabama.

He was preceded in death by his parents; 2 wives; son, Jeremy Laue; daughter, Kelly Laue; brother, James Laue; and sister, Carolyn Mick.
